The core principle of plinko revolves around dropping a puck from the top of a pyramid-shaped board filled with pegs. As the puck descends, it randomly bounces off these pegs, changing direction with each impact. The puck ultimately lands in one of several slots at the bottom of the board, each associated with a different prize multiplier. The randomness inherent in the bounces creates an element of unpredictability and excitement that is central to the plinko experience. Players often have the option to select where they would like to place their bet, influencing where the puck is initially dropped. This affects the potential path it can take and therefore the likely outcome.
The prize multipliers attributed to each slot vary, typically ranging from modest increases to substantial boosts. Higher multipliers are generally associated with slots that are harder to reach, requiring a more fortunate sequence of bounces to land within. This dynamic creates a risk-reward scenario, where players must weigh the probability of hitting a higher payout against the allure of a more significant win. The Return to Player (RTP) percentage is a crucial factor to consider when evaluating any casino game, and plinko is no exception. This percentage represents the average amount of money that is returned to players over an extended period. A higher RTP means a greater chance of long-term profitability. While some plinko versions boast commendable RTP rates, it’s imperative to check the specific rate before you begin playing. Understanding the concept of volatility and its impact on your gameplay is also crucial. High-volatility plinko games offer larger potential wins, but they also come with a greater risk of losing streaks. Lower-volatility games, on the other hand, provide smaller, more frequent payouts. Choosing the type of game that aligns with your risk tolerance and playing style is important for maximizing your enjoyment and potentially minimizing losses.

The Martingale strategy, widely used in various casino games, involves doubling your bet after each loss, hoping to recover your losses with a single win. While this strategy can work in the short term, it can quickly deplete your budget if you encounter a prolonged losing streak. Therefore, it’s advisable to exercise caution and set strict limits when employing the Martingale strategy in plinko. A reverse martingale strategy involves increasing bets after wins and decreasing bets after losses – presenting a more moderate risk.

Problem gambling can manifest itself in a variety of ways; an inability to control spending on gambling, persistent thoughts about previous losses, and lying about your gambling habits are all red flags. Feelings of restlessness or irritability when trying to cut back or stop gambling also suggest a potential issue. Furthermore, using gambling as an escape from everyday worries is a concerning indicator.
Recognizing that you might have a gambling problem is the first step towards recovery. Confidential and accessible resources are readily available.
